release of the iOS4 we are able to distribute iPhone applications "Over The Air" (i.e: directly downloading http://blog.octo.com/en/automating-over-the-air-deployment-for-iphone/ the application from the iPhone without using iTunes). This greatly simplifies the deployment process especially for entreprises where iTunes is rarely a corporate tool. It also allows you to https://docs.oracle.com/middleware/1221/wcs/tag-ref/MISC/errno.html create your own enterprise App Store. But until now it was a fully manual process : not anymore ! In this article we'll see how to automate the cannot read deployment with a software factory, thus making the deployment more reliable and more productive. The missing command line : Over the air deployment is based on a new command in the build menu of Xcode called "build and archive" which packages the application with an embedded provisioning profile. There have been many questions on how to integrate resourcerules.plist: cannot read this feature in a continuous integration process. The "xcodebuild" command is well known : it builds an Xcode project from the command line and generates an ".app" file. You can use this command to build your application from a script ran by a software factory. But the generated file cannot be distributed over the air since it misses the embedded provisioning profile. We need to build the project into an “.ipa” file, containing the provisioning profile and signed with your developper identity. To be able to find the command line, the trick was to watch the system console log while running a "build and archive" through Xcode.
